- Relevance: [Isoform Holin]: Accumulates harmlessly in the cytoplasmic membrane until it reaches a critical concentration that triggers the formation of micron-scale pores (holes) causing host cell membrane disruption and endolysin escape into the periplasmic space. Determines the precise timing of host cell lysis. Participates with the endolysin and spanin proteins in the sequential events which lead to the programmed host cell lysis releasing the mature viral particles from the host cell. ; [Isoform Antiholin]: Counteracts the aggregation of the holin molecules and thus of pore formation.
